Allegheny Airlines February 1979 Timetable ZipDive!  Download

File Description:
Here is an Excel copy of the February 1, 1979, system timetable for Allegheny Airlines. This Excel version was complied from the original print copy. Allegheny was the forerunner of today's US Airways. Aircraft used at the time include the Boeing 727-100, Douglas DC-9, and the BAC One-Eleven. Fly the routes of the Vista-jets!

American Airlines April 1963 Timetable ZipDive!  Download

File Description:
Here is an Excel copy of the April 28, 1963, system timetable for American Airlines. This timetable was complied from the original paper copy, and retains the look of an old-style, directional timetable. Aircraft used by American at this time include the Boeing 707, Convair 240 and 990, and Douglas DC-6 and DC-7. Fly the routes of the Flagships!

An American Pilot's Guide to Virtual Flying in Poland ZipDive!  Download

File Description:
A guide to help American virtual pilots while flying on VATSIM to understand the procedures of Polish airspace (which I understand to be generally used throughout Europe and the UK except for some local variations) and to recognize some differences between those procedures and the commonly used procedures and phraseology in the US (which are also built into Flight Simulator ATC).
